Danone

Danone is one of the world’s leading fast moving consumer goods (FMCG) companies. It currently has four business subsidiaries operating in the UK: Danone Dairies, Danone Water, Early Life Nutrition and Medical Nutrition. Collectively these four businesses control some of the most popular brands in the UK today and the company is renowned for both the products it represents and the people it employs.

Salesforce implementation

The Customer Operations division in Danone Nutricia Medical Nutrition embarked on a strategic transformation programme to provide a 360 view of the customer. Part of this programme involved bringing together multiple operational systems under one central customer services portal to drive efficiencies and improve customer service. We were brought in to manage the day to day implementation of the programme as well as the change management workstream. As part of this 2 year long project we also developed and implemented a standard change methodology for Danone Nutricia and built internal capability to ensure future change can be successfully led in-house.

Supply Chain improvement programme

The Supply Chain team at Danone Nutricia Medical Nutrition had initiated an improvement programme aiming to reduce operational costs in the UK and improve collaboration with key customers. Our business analysts were brought on-board to investigate a number of supply chain simplification projects. We developed multiple business cases and supported the team to prioritise the programmes of work, in line with their company objectives.

Innovation Roadmap

The Danone Nutricia Early Life Nutrition business was looking for innovative and creative solutions to further attract, delight and retain their customers for the Aptimil and Cow & Gate brands. Nine Feet Tall facilitated a series of workshops with Danone and its customers to identify and prioritise ideas to improve client loyalty and developed the ELN Innovation Roadmap. We subsequently led a Proof of Concept exercise for one of the strategic initiatives to radically change the product returns experience, with London based and then global pilots.

New CRM Implementation

The project brief was to implement a new CRM to support Danone’s business reorganisation and to be rolled out across all Danone territories, globally. Nine Feet Tall worked as a pivot between the supplier and the client; brokering requirements, functionality, budget, contract commitments and governance structure. On-going HyperCare after launch ensured open communications channels between users, client and supplier continued.
